When a Test is Selected:
The QC Interval Controls
Expired option is set to
Warn or Lockout, and one
or more control tests is
past due.
(The menu item 2 –
Continue appears only if
this option is set to Warn).
If the option is set to
Lockout, each control test
shown on the screen must
be performed before the
patient tests start.
Perform the control tests
indicated in the message.
Press 1 to Exit.
or
If it appears, press 2 to
continue patient testing.
The Upload Interval
option is set to Warn or
Lockout, and the specified
interval has been
exceeded.
(The menu item 2 –
Continue appears only if
this option is set to Warn).
If the option is set to
Lockout, data must be
uploaded before testing
starts.
1. To upload data, do one
of the following:
Place the monitor in the
docking station (if the
system has this option).
Plug the communications
cable into the data port
and connect to the laptop.
(Refer to QC Manager
Manual).
2. If the problem persists,
notify the system
administrator.
Press 1 to exit.
or
If it appears, press 2 to
continue testing.
